The benefits of massage therapy

Research suggests that massage has a range of benefits. It is recommended to treat yourself to a massage once a while to relax your body and improve your wellbeing. Here are some of the benefits that a full body massage therapy session may provide:

Increased relaxation.

Reduced muscle tension.

Increased joint flexibility and mobility,

Improved recovery and soft tissue injuries.

Improved circulation.

Reduced stress.

Although these benefits can be quite general, different types of massage therapies such as healing massage therapy can support and manage mental disorders such as anxiety, insomnia and depression. They can also be used to support people with a chronic disease or cancer. Sports massage applies therapeutic and deep tissue techniques to enhance performance and aid overworked muscles in recovering quickly.

Massage Therapy - Common Questions

What is massage therapy?

Massage therapy involves putting pressure on muscles, connective tissues, tendons, ligaments and rubbing them. When used to improve health and wellbeing, it is referred as massage therapy.

What does a massage therapist do?

Massage therapists treat people by using flowing strokes, kneading and gentle manipulations of the muscles and other soft tissues of the body. They relieve pain and may help you heal injuries, improve circulation and relaxation, and relieve stress.

What's the difference between a massage therapist and a remedial massage therapist?

A remedial massage therapist is a practitioner who deals with muscle tension or chronic pain and can work out a plan just for you and your health issues. A general massage therapist will be able to give you a massage to relax your mind and rejuvenate your tired body.

Will insurance cover massage therapy?

Some insurance policies cover massage therapy, depending on the level of extras you've chosen. With rebates, there are typically restrictions or might only cover a portion of it. Best to check with your insurance provider and massage therapist before you make a booking.

How much does massage therapy cost?

Depending on the location, type of therapy and level of services you require, the costs may vary. A massage therapy session generally starts at $60 to $200 an hour.
